Form 4: Vivid Seats CFO Acquires Shares, Vesting Schedule Detailed

Sentiment:

Insider Transaction Report


Vivid Seats Inc. reports on a Form 4 filing detailing transactions by Chief Financial Officer Thomas Joseph D. Jr., including the acquisition of shares and restricted stock units with a phased vesting schedule.

Summary

  • Thomas Joseph D. Jr., Chief Financial Officer of Vivid Seats Inc., engaged in transactions involving Class A Common Stock and Restricted Stock Units (RSUs).
  • On June 11, 2026, 19,113 RSUs were acquired, with one-eighth vesting immediately and the remainder vesting quarterly until December 11, 2027.
  • Additionally, 4,654 shares of Class A Common Stock were disposed of at a price of $8.53 per share.
  • Following these transactions, the reporting person beneficially owns 30,266 shares of Class A Common Stock directly.
